Summary:
This core course provides a comprehensive understanding of how to use QuickTest Professional 11 (QTP) as an automated functional testing tool. This course is designed for manual testers who need to understand how to create basic automated tests.
Course materials focus on the QTP Graphical User Interface to record and playback tests and make test enhancements by adding checkpoints and synchronization points. Emphasis is placed on test modularization to improve reusability.
Participants receive instruction on how QTP identifies testing objects, how to use and manage the Object Repository, how to use the Object Spy, and how to use the QTP configuration options to configure QTP to interact with the application under test.
All topics are supported by hands-on exercises based on real-life examples. Exercises start with a Windows application and move to Web objects.
Duration:
2.5 Days/Lecture & Lab
Audience:
This course is designed for New Automation Testers, Business Analysts and QA Project Leads.
Topics:
Prerequisites:
Before attending this course, students should understand basic concepts of Quality Assurance (QA) and have working knowledge of Windows software.
